Zhengkun Zhou is a scholar working on Plant Science, Environmental Engineering and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Zhengkun Zhou has authored 23 papers receiving a total of 587 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Plant Science, 4 papers in Environmental Engineering and 3 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Zhengkun Zhou’s work include Groundwater flow and contamination studies (4 papers), Mycotoxins in Agriculture and Food (4 papers) and Enhanced Oil Recovery Techniques (2 papers). Zhengkun Zhou is often cited by papers focused on Groundwater flow and contamination studies (4 papers), Mycotoxins in Agriculture and Food (4 papers) and Enhanced Oil Recovery Techniques (2 papers). Zhengkun Zhou coll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Canada. Zhengkun Zhou's co-authors include Tianli Yue, Tung-Ching Lee, Ying Luo, Yahong Yuan, Ke Xing, Cong Liu, Weijie Liu, Jihong Jiang, Liang Liu and Yanzhen Wang and has published in prestigious journals such as Water Resources Research, Food Chemistry and Gene.
